What are the closest trade schools to Crowell, Texas, and what programs do they offer?

The closest trade schools to Crowell include Texas State Technical College (TSTC) in Wichita Falls (about 90 minutes away), Vernon College in Vernon (about 45 minutes away), and the Red River Institute of Vocational & Technical Education in Wichita Falls. These schools offer programs like Welding Technology, HVAC, Electrical Lineworker, Automotive Technology, Diesel Equipment, and Precision Manufacturing, which are highly relevant to the North Texas job market.

What certifications can I earn through trade programs near Crowell that are in high demand locally?

Programs at nearby schools offer certifications like AWS (American Welding Society) for welding, EPA Section 608 for HVAC/R, NCCER (National Center for Construction Education and Research) for electrical and carpentry, and CDL for diesel equipment. These certifications are highly valued by employers in North Texas's construction, energy, and agricultural sectors, providing a direct path to stable careers.
